Kawasaki Zephyr 550 - 1997 Specifications and Reviews

The 1997 Kawasaki Zephyr 550 is a lightweight naked bike ideal for beginner and intermediate riders seeking nimble handling and accessible performance. Its 553cc four-cylinder engine delivers smooth power with a low seat height, making it perfect for urban commuting and spirited weekend rides. Known for its reliability and classic styling, this middleweight offers an excellent platform for learning modern motorcycle fundamentals.

Rider Profile

Best ForA friendly, forgiving machine well suited to newer riders or those returning to biking after a break, thanks to its modest power and classic, predictable handling.
PurposeBest suited to relaxed city riding, weekend backroad cruising, and enjoying a retro air-cooled four-cylinder character rather than chasing outright performance.
Rider FitThe low seat height and moderate weight make it accessible to shorter or less experienced riders, with manageable ergonomics for everyday use.
CharacterA charming, old-school naked bike that rewards smooth, unhurried riding with a classic inline-four soundtrack and light, nimble low-speed manners.
Not Ideal ForNot the right choice for riders wanting strong overtaking power, long-distance touring comfort, or any serious off-road capability.
